Understanding the Core Mechanics of Online Ice Fishing Games
At the heart of any good online ice fishing game lies a robust set of core mechanics. These often include realistic fish AI, meaning the fish behave in ways that align with their real-world counterparts – they respond to bait, water temperature, and time of day. Successful gameplay demands more than just luck; it requires careful observation, strategic decision-making, and an understanding of the virtual ecosystem. Players will often need to upgrade their equipment and learn new techniques in order to move forward.
Choosing the right location is paramount. Different areas possess varying types of fish, ice conditions, and ideal fishing times. Additionally, selecting the appropriate bait and tackle is essential. A poorly chosen lure can result in a long wait and an empty hole, while the correct combination dramatically increases your chances of a successful catch. Understanding these elements is crucial for progressing through the game and mastering the art of virtual ice fishing.

Essential Equipment and Upgrades
Like real-life ice fishing, online games typically feature a range of equipment that players can acquire and upgrade. These might include ice shelters for protection from the (virtual) elements, augers to drill holes, depth finders to locate fish, and specialized rods and reels. Investing in better equipment not only enhances the gameplay experience but also increases your chances of landing bigger and more valuable fish.
Upgrades can range from simply improving the quality of your gear to unlocking new features or abilities. A more advanced auger might drill holes faster, while a high-end depth finder could reveal hidden fish hotspots. Furthermore, many games offer cosmetic customization options, allowing players to personalize their avatar and equipment for a unique look and feel. Understanding which upgrades provide the greatest benefits is a key strategic aspect of successful gameplay.
Advanced Fishing Techniques
Beyond simply dropping a line into the ice, mastering advanced fishing techniques can significantly improve your results in these games. This often involves understanding the nuances of different bait presentations, such as jigging, tip-ups, and using live bait effectively. Each technique has its advantages and disadvantages, depending on the species you’re targeting and the conditions you’re facing.
Furthermore, skill-based mini-games are often incorporated during the actual fishing process, requiring players to accurately time their hook sets and manage the line tension to reel in their catch. These elements add a layer of challenge and skill to the gameplay, rewarding players who have honed their reflexes and understanding of fish behavior. Successful execution of these techniques will yield larger catches and boost your overall score.
Understanding Fish Species and Habitats
Each species of fish within the game possesses unique characteristics, including its preferred habitat, diet, and behavior. Learning to identify these nuances is crucial for targeting specific species and maximizing your catch rate. For example, trout may prefer colder waters and flowing currents, while walleye might gravitate towards deeper, darker areas.
Understanding the time of day and seasonal patterns also plays a vital role. Certain species might be more active during dawn or dusk, or during specific spawning seasons. Paying attention to these details and adapting your strategy accordingly is essential for consistently successful fishing. Many games provide detailed information about each species, allowing players to study their habits and tailor their approach.
